■(BB) 'Gemini'
1965, Knopf
'Gemini' (
Maynard Knopf, R. 1965). Seedling #64-2. BB, 26" (66 cm), Late midseason bloom. Pale violet self (Wilson 634/3); self beard.
'El Camino Real' X
'Orchid Jewel'. Knopf-Tell 1966. Honorable Mention 1968, Judges Choice 1969.

References:
From Knopf Iris Gardens catalog,1966: GEMINI:- Sdlg. No. 64-2 BB 26" ML. El Camino Real x Orchid Jewel. Light violet self (cobalt violet Wilson 634 / 3) We are high on this flower for it is a beauty with ruffled, laced parts. Substance is outstanding. Standards are closed. Falls flare horizontally. Eye-catcher. Net $25.00 |
